The Samsung Galaxy A52 has an overall score of 90.7, which is better than the Xiaomi Redmi Note 6 Pro's global score of 77.2. The Samsung Galaxy A52 is a a little bit heavier cellphone than the Xiaomi Redmi Note 6 Pro, but both are 0.33inches thick. Samsung Galaxy A52 counts with a little better performance than Xiaomi Redmi Note 6 Pro. They have the same number of cores and 6 GB of RAM memory.
The Xiaomi Redmi Note 6 Pro counts with a slightly better screen than Galaxy A52, although it has a little smaller screen, a little lower pixels density and a little worse 1080 x 2280 resolution. Samsung Galaxy A52 features a superior storage to install applications and games than Xiaomi Redmi Note 6 Pro, because it has a slot for an SD memory card that admits a maximum of 1 TB and more internal memory.
The Galaxy A52 has a bit superior battery life than Xiaomi Redmi Note 6 Pro, because it has 4500mAh of battery capacity. The Samsung Galaxy A52 counts with a very superior camera than Xiaomi Redmi Note 6 Pro, because it has a camera with much more mega pixels, a lot better 3840x2160 (4K) video quality, a much larger back-facing camera sensor which offers a lot higher image and video quality and a larger aperture to capture better photography in low-light environments.
